Beaux-Arts architecture is a monumental building style named after the École des Beaux-Arts in Paris, where it was taught during the late 19th and early 20th centuries. The style builds on the symmetry and proportions of Roman and Greek classicism, then layers on French and Italian Renaissance and Baroque influences. It became the preferred language for government and institutional buildings across Europe and North America, and it also defined the opulent private mansions of the Gilded Age. Because the style spread through a formal architecture education system rather than through individual builders, its rules stayed consistent from city to city, which is why landmarks in Paris, New York, and Chicago belong to the same visual family.

The History of Beaux-Arts Architecture
The story starts in Paris. The École des Beaux-Arts grew out of the Académie royale d’architecture, founded in 1648, and took its modern form in 1819, when the school was reorganized after the French Revolution. Students trained in private ateliers under practicing architects and competed for the Prix de Rome, a scholarship that sent winners to study the ancient buildings of Rome and Greece. That curriculum produced a generation of designers fluent in classical proportion and eager to apply it at civic scale.
The École des Beaux-Arts and the Paris Training System
The method taught at the school revolved around the parti, the governing idea of a plan. Students learned to express that idea through symmetrical axes, graded hierarchies of spaces, and a clear circulation diagram drawn before any detail work began. Drawing competitions, not written exams, decided advancement, so students graduated with exceptional drafting skills and a shared visual vocabulary. The program typically stretched over six to ten years, and the ateliers operated like small professional offices, which is why so many graduates moved directly into major commissions.
Gilded Age Arrival in the United States
American architects began enrolling in Paris in the 1840s. Richard Morris Hunt, the first American to attend the school, returned in 1855 and designed the Fifth Avenue facade of the Metropolitan Museum of Art. H. H. Richardson and Charles McKim, whose firm McKim, Mead and White dominated American civic work, trained there as well. Defining Characteristics of the Style
A Beaux-Arts building announces itself from a block away. It demands symmetry, a clear hierarchy of parts, and abundant sculptural ornament, all drawn from a classical vocabulary that would have looked familiar to a Roman architect.
Classical Vocabulary at Monumental Scale
Columns and pilasters in the Corinthian or Ionic orders carry entablatures and pediments. Arches, balustrades, quoins, and rusticated stone define the wall surfaces, while cartouches, garlands, medallions, and freestanding sculpture fill the remaining space. Bronze doors, urns, and iron railings finish the composition in metal. Composition and Hierarchy
Symmetry governs the plan and the elevation. A central pavilion, usually taller and more decorated than the wings, anchors the composition, and a grand entrance stair leads to a double-height lobby. Axial planning extends the building into the city: approaches, courtyards, and planting align with the main entrance so the structure reads as the climax of its setting.
Inside, the plan arranges rooms along a central axis with the grandest space at the end of the vista. Circulation is ceremonial: visitors climb a wide stair, pass through a sequence of halls, and arrive at the principal salon. Service spaces hide in wings and basements so the public rooms stay uninterrupted.
The Tripartite Facade
Most Beaux-Arts facades divide vertically into three bands. A rusticated base supports a columned middle where the principal rooms sit, and a balustraded attic or mansard roof crowns the wall. Proportions follow simple fractions of the total height, with the middle band usually taking about half, so the whole composition stays legible from street level.
Materials and Construction Methods
Behind the marble and limestone, Beaux-Arts buildings were surprisingly modern. Builders combined load-bearing masonry with iron and steel framing, which permitted larger windows and wider column-free interiors than older classical buildings could achieve.
Stone, Iron, and Steel
Limestone and marble form the exterior skin, with granite reserved for the base where traffic and moisture do the most damage. Structural steel hides behind the masonry, and terracotta appears in cornices and ornamental details where it costs less than carved stone. Bronze appears in doors, railings, and light fixtures, while interiors use marble, gilding, and painted murals.

Notable Landmark Examples
The fastest way to learn the style is to study its best-known buildings. The Paris Opera, begun in 1861 by Charles Garnier, is often called the defining monument of the movement.
Paris Landmarks
Alongside the Opera, the Grand Palais and Petit Palais, built for the 1900 Exposition, show the style at full scale, with iron-and-glass halls wrapped in stone. The Pont Alexandre III carries its sculpture across the Seine, and the Gare de Lyon brings Beaux-Arts grandeur to the railroad station.
American Civic Landmarks
In the United States the style produced Grand Central Terminal in New York, completed in 1913, the New York Public Library main branch by Carrère and Hastings, and the classical facades of the Metropolitan Museum of Art. Union stations in Washington, Chicago, and dozens of other cities followed the same formula. How to Identify a Beaux-Arts Building
Identify a Beaux-Arts building in the field with a short checklist. Answer these questions before calling a structure Beaux-Arts rather than another classical revival style.
A Field Checklist
- Is the facade perfectly symmetrical around a central axis?
- Is there a central pavilion or entrance taller or more decorated than the wings?
- Does the facade divide into a rusticated base, a columned middle, and a balustraded attic?
- Do columns or pilasters use the classical orders, usually Corinthian or Ionic?
- Does the building carry sculpture, garlands, cartouches, or bronze doors?
- Does the interior open into a grand double-height lobby or stair hall?

Preservation and Adaptive Reuse
Preserving a Beaux-Arts building is a team effort that starts long before scaffolding goes up. Documentation, gentle cleaning, and compatible materials decide whether the work protects the landmark or damages it.
Restoration Priorities
- Document the facade and interior before any work begins.
- Clean with low-pressure methods; sandblasting destroys carved stone.
- Repair original stone where possible; match new stone to the original quarry.
- Restore windows rather than replacing them wholesale.
- Use paint analysis to reproduce the period color scheme.
Respecting the Original Assembly
The final rule of Beaux-Arts conservation is to respect the original materiality of the building. New stone must match the original quarry, mortar must be softer than the masonry it protects, and paint systems must reproduce the lime-based finishes of the period. Done well, a restored Beaux-Arts building continues to do the job it was built for a century after it opened.
